Augmodo raises $21M to instrument the store worker

Augmodo raised $21 million at a $350 million valuation, in a round led by TQ Ventures with Lerer Hippeau, Arena Holdings, Jefferson River Capital, and strategic backers including the pharmacy chain Chemist Warehouse, SiliconANGLE reported on July 13. The company sells a Smartbadge, a wearable that store associates clip on and forget, which continuously scans the aisles around them as they work and feeds a real-time store map the company calls a Realogram. The pitch is inventory accuracy and stock-out prevention captured as a byproduct of work the staff are already doing.

The traction numbers explain the valuation. Augmodo says revenue grew roughly tenfold over the past year, that it now maps about 186 million square feet of retail floor a month, and that it expects to reach a billion by year-end while adding 50 to 100 store locations monthly. CEO Ross Finman describes the mission as 'AI system for the physical workforce.' The enhanced badge adds a walkie-talkie, a digital identity display, and an optional panic button, which turns a data-capture device into something a worker has a reason to want to wear.

The wearable bet is a fresh answer to shelf data

Every retailer wants a live, accurate picture of what is actually on the shelf, and the industry has tried several routes to get it: fixed ceiling cameras, shelf-edge sensors, robots that roam the aisles at night, and phone apps that ask staff to scan. Augmodo's answer is to attach the sensor to the person who is already walking every aisle. The badge captures shelf state passively, without adding a task to a shift that is already full. That design choice is the whole thesis, because the common failure mode of store-execution technology is that it depends on someone reliably doing extra work.

The economics of passive capture are attractive if the accuracy holds. A wearable that maps the store as a side effect of normal work spreads sensing across every associate on the floor and every hour they work. Set against a nightly robot pass or a fixed-camera install, it scales with headcount instead of capital expenditure, and it captures the store in the state customers actually see it during the day. The open question is data quality: passive scans from a moving badge are messier than a fixed camera's, and the value depends entirely on whether the models clean that signal into a reliable Realogram.

Store execution is suddenly a fundable category

Investors are writing checks against store execution because the payoff is finally legible. Out-of-stocks are a direct, measurable revenue leak, and a live shelf map plugs straight into replenishment, ecommerce availability, and the fulfillment promises retailers now make for same-day pickup and delivery. When a retailer offers 30-minute pickup, the accuracy of its shelf data becomes the thing that determines whether the order can be fulfilled at all. That is why a company selling badges to store staff can command a $350 million valuation in 2026.

The agentic layer sharpens the case further. AI agents that reorder inventory, rebalance stock, or quote availability to a shopping bot are only as good as the ground-truth data underneath them, and store shelves are the noisiest, least-instrumented part of the whole chain. Whoever owns accurate, real-time shelf data owns an input that every downstream agent needs. Augmodo is betting that the cheapest way to capture that data at scale is to clip a sensor to the workforce already in motion, and the early revenue curve suggests the bet is landing.

The build-versus-buy and labor questions

For a retail technology leader, this is a clean build-versus-buy decision, and the buy case is strong. Instrumenting store execution in-house means hardware, computer vision, and a mapping pipeline, none of which is a retailer's core competency and all of which a specialist is iterating on faster. Buying the capability as a wearable service lets you get shelf data without standing up a hardware and ML team. The trade is dependence on a young vendor for a data feed that could become load-bearing across replenishment and fulfillment, which argues for a contract that guarantees data portability from the start.

The labor dimension deserves honest attention. A badge that continuously scans the floor also, by construction, records where associates go and how they move. Augmodo softens this with genuinely worker-useful features like the walkie-talkie and panic button, and that is smart product design. It leaves the surveillance question intact. Any retailer deploying this should be explicit with staff and, where relevant, with works councils and unions about what the badge captures and how it is used, because a store-execution tool the workforce distrusts will be quietly defeated on the floor.

The horizontal thesis and what to watch

Augmodo is already positioning beyond retail. Finman argues the underlying problem is universal, that 'someone grabbing a wrench in an automotive factory isn't that different from someone grabbing a Cheerios box,' and the company names warehouses, manufacturing, hospitals, and automotive as expansion targets. The addressable market for a spatial AI system aimed at the roughly 80 percent of the workforce that works with their hands is enormous, and it is the story that justifies a $350 million price on early revenue. Horizontal ambition of that kind is also where young hardware companies most often overreach.

For retail leaders, the near-term signal is what matters. A well-funded, fast-growing vendor is making shelf data cheaper and more current, and that lowers the barrier to the availability-dependent services retail is racing to offer. We would pilot it against a hard metric, out-of-stock reduction or fulfillment accuracy on same-day orders, and insist on exporting the raw Realogram data into your own systems. The capability is worth adopting. The dependency on a Series A vendor for a load-bearing data feed is worth structuring carefully before it becomes hard to unwind.
